Home > Runtime Error > What Is Runtime Error C

What Is Runtime Error C

Contents

Program execution is suspended and an error dialog appears, as shown in Figure 10. However, the value returned may not be 25. While the attempt to analyze sandyroddick's question is greatly appreciated, edits to questions are reserved for improvements to the question, not answers/corrections/clarifications to the question by third parties. I'd suggest putting your proposed code changes in comments or, if they're substantive, in your own answer, rather than editing the original poster's question. weblink

Try this list of free services. Bar to add a line break simply add two spaces to where you would like the new line to be. Figure 12: Closeup of error message from Figure 10. As suggested, you could use malloc() to allocate this memory on the heap. http://techterms.com/definition/runtime_error

Runtime Error In C++

Linker Errors If you receive a linker error, it means that your code compiles fine, but that some function or library that is needed cannot be found. The result is a powerful tool to find, diagnose, and fix a variety of runtime errors in your C code. Error shown while submitting program About CodeChef About Directi CEO's Corner CodeChef Campus Chapters CodeChef For Schools Contact Us © 2009, Directi Group. Stack error Accessing *p when p points to a local variable of a function f() after f() has returned.

What commercial flight route has the biggest number of (minimum possible) stops/layovers from A to B? Use this handy guide to compare... Buffer overrun Accessing *p when the value of p has been incremented to point past the end of its target. How To Fix Runtime Error In C Uninitialized local variable A local variable of a function is not initialized before it is read.

There are two severities of messages the compiler can give: Compiler Warnings A compiler warning indicates you've done something bad, but not something that will prevent the code from being compiled. As is the case with other memory errors, there is often a delay between the point where the uninitialized memory read occurs and the point where observable erroneous behavior occurs. This is because when integer calculation results are too large to fit in the container type, the result is truncated by the most significant bits which do not fit. PREVIOUSruntimeNEXTruntime version Related Links Troubleshooting Run-Time Error Messages TECH RESOURCES FROM OUR PARTNERS WEBOPEDIA WEEKLY Stay up to date on the latest developments in Internet terminology with a free weekly newsletter

Lütfen daha sonra yeniden deneyin. 12 Eki 2013 tarihinde yayınlandıhttp://repair-your-pc.net/Want to know how to fix runtime error? Logical Error In C If you do really need that much memory, try allocating it in the heap instead: change the global to a pointer: int *a; at the start of main() a = malloc(sizeof(int)*100000001); Common examples include dividing by zero, referencing missing files, calling invalid functions, or not handling certain input correctly. GiraffeOnDope 107.398 görüntüleme 6:43 How To Fix Runtime Error R6002 Floating Point Support Not Loaded - Süre: 1:07.

Runtime Error In Codechef

Crashes can be caused by memory leaks or other programming errors. Get More Information Memory errors can be very difficult to debug using a traditional debugger because there is often a long delay between the point where the memory error occurs and the point where Runtime Error In C++ For example, a miscalculation in the source code or a spreadsheet program may produce the wrong result when a user enters a formula into a cell. What Causes Runtime Errors In C A memory leak may be due to an infinite loop, not deallocating unused memory, or other reasons.

Updated: April 27, 2012 Cite this definition: APAMLAChicagoHTMLLink http://techterms.com/definition/runtime_error TechTerms - The Tech Terms Computer Dictionary This page contains a technical definiton of Runtime Error. have a peek at these guys TeraByte57 6.166 görüntüleme 0:46 Daha fazla öneri yükleniyor... You can assume that every integer between 1 and n appears exactly once in the permutation. Whenever Reactis for C is simulating C code in Simulator or generating tests in Tester, it is also performing a multitude of checks for runtime errors. Runtime Error Example Java

Nonetheless, errors often occur on the lines prior to what the error message lists. Please post the error log –arunmoezhi Aug 23 '12 at 18:00 1 @sandyroddick: jblevins.org/log/segfault –arunmoezhi Aug 23 '12 at 19:00 | show 4 more comments 4 Answers 4 active oldest Figure 10: Memory error detected by Reactis for C. check over here In this case the variable is buf2.

E.g. Causes Of Runtime Error In C Example: Your code calls the pow() (raise to a power) library function, but you forgot to include math.h. What makes an actor an A-lister Composition of Derangements How to use sort on an awk print command?

jodd lana 57.788 görüntüleme 1:07 help how to fix microsoft visual c++ runtime library - Süre: 1:57.

The memory error is immediately caught and its location (the assignment x = *p) is highlighted. It is also common for memory errors to only occur in rare circumstances, such as when a very large buffer size is requested or a complex boolean expression becomes true. Figure 11: Highlighting the location of a memory error. Reason For Runtime Error In C Is the sum of singular and nonsingular matrix always a nonsingular matrix?

It affects performance, and the end user is not implemented in the debugging output anyway. In Reactis for C, the target of the pointer is immediately available. If you find this Runtime Error definition to be helpful, you can reference it using the citation links above. http://3cq.org/runtime-error/what-is-a-runtime-error-in-c.php In contrast, compile-time errors occur while a program is being compiled.

This result is then used for subsequent program calculations and may not result in an observable program malfunction (such as an incorrect output) until much later, making the source of the A memory error occurs whenever a program reads-from or writes-to an invalid address. Nonetheless, other systems and compilers will provide similar information. int values[10]; int i; cout << "The ith value is: " << values[i] << endl; may cause such an error.

Learn more You're viewing YouTube in Turkish. Bu özellik şu anda kullanılamıyor. It should not segfault. –charliehorse55 Aug 23 '12 at 19:34 add a comment| up vote 0 down vote Hey first of all good question :-) "+1" for that. Dilinizi seçin.

NMR Video Collection Tutorial&Gameplay 310.304 görüntüleme 3:21 How to fix run-time error -2147467259 - Süre: 3:19.